Office Administrator
2 weeks ago
The Office Administrator will report to the Office Manager and will be responsible for the General Office Maintenance and Office Administration.
**General Office Maintenance**
- Ensure Office facilities are in order and Office environment is kept clean and tidy.
- Ensure the inventory level of pantry and office supplies are well maintained.
- Coordinate with vendors for renewal of Office Maintenance Services and to ensure Office maintenance work is conducted timely as per Service Agreement.
- Liaise with the Office Building Maintenance Team for any matters relating to Office facilities matters.
**Office Administrative Support**
- Assist with flight, visa arrangement and hotel arrangement.
- Verification of SG&A invoices and staff claims before obtaining approval.
- SG&A Vendor Maintenance: Co-ordinate with SG&A Vendors to obtain the necessary documentation and information for creation and updating in the system.
- Assist with sourcing and conduct quotations comparison for office purchases, maintenance, and services, when necessary
- Assist with the onboarding of new joiners.
- Assist with organizing Company events and corporate gift purchases.
- Coordination of local and overseas courier services
- Co-ordinate with appointed vendor for archiving, destruction and retrieval of documents.
- Assist with filing, scanning, and photocopying of documents.
- Receiving and directing visitors
- Handle incoming and outgoing mails and Office mainline incoming phone calls.
- Run office errands when necessary (i.e.to the Banks) To assist with other office administrative duties as assigned
**General Skills & Attributes**
- Ability to work independently.
- Detail-oriented and ability to maintain confidentiality.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ills to effectively interact with inter department, including the Management.
- Proactive with strong initiative and positive working attitude
